我需要在等式中使用带小数点的值,但是当我输入它们时,由于整个“浮动”的东西,它不起作用。
我怎样才能改变这个来得到答案?
def windowvars(deltP, mu, L, outR, inR):
v = (deltP/(4.0*mu*L))(outR**2-inR**2)
print(v)
windowvars(60, 0.000018, 1.0, .5, .5)
这些是我需要使用的数字。
答案 0 :(得分:1)
你想要得到什么结果?
从我看到你正在使用
def windowvars(deltP, mu, L, outR, inR):
v = (deltP/(4.0*mu**L))*(outR*2-inR*2)
print("{:.10f}".format(v))
作为你的功能,
(outR*2-inR*2)
你的函数的这一部分根据你输入的0.5和0.5创建一个零,方程是否正确?